Python | Método de cuantización decimal()

Decimal#quantize() : quantize() es un método de clase Decimal que devuelve un valor igual al primer valor decimal (redondeado) que tiene el exponente del segundo valor decimal. Sintaxis: Decimal.quantize() Parámetro: Valores decimales Devuelve: un valor igual al primer valor decimal (redondeado) que tiene el exponente del segundo valor decimal. Código #1: Ejemplo para el método … Continue reading «Python | Método de cuantización decimal()»

Python | Método decimal number_class()

Decimal#number_class() : number_class() es un método de clase Decimal que devuelve la indicación de la clase de valor Decimal. Syntax: Decimal.number_class() Parameter: Decimal values Return: indication of the class of Decimal value. Código #1: Ejemplo para el método number_class() # Python Program explaining  # number_class() method    # loading decimal library from decimal import * … Continue reading «Python | Método decimal number_class()»

Función Curry en Python

En la resolución de problemas y la programación funcional, curry es la práctica de simplificar la ejecución de una función que toma múltiples argumentos para ejecutar funciones secuenciales de un solo argumento. En términos simples, Currying se utiliza para transformar una función de varios argumentos en una función de un solo argumento mediante la evaluación … Continue reading «Función Curry en Python»

Función delattr() de Python

La función delattr() de Python se utiliza para eliminar atributos de una clase. Toma dos argumentos, el primero es el objeto de clase del que queremos eliminar, el segundo es el nombre del atributo que queremos eliminar. Sintaxis delattr (object, name) Parámetros Parámetro Descripción objeto Un objeto del que queremos eliminar el atributo. nombre El … Continue reading «Función delattr() de Python»

Función Python invertida()

El método Python reversed() devuelve un iterador que accede a la secuencia dada en el orden inverso. Sintaxis de Python invertida() invertido (secuencia)  Python invertido() Parámetros sequ : Secuencia a invertir.  Python invertido() Devoluciones devuelve un iterador que accede a la secuencia dada en el orden inverso.  ¿Cómo usar el método inverso en Python? Ejemplo … Continue reading «Función Python invertida()»

¿Cómo obtener una lista de nombres de parámetros de una función en Python?

En este artículo, vamos a discutir cómo obtener parámetros de lista de una función en Python. inspeccionar de theget la lista de parámetros nombre: la Python3 # import required modules import inspect import collections    # use signature() print(inspect.signature(collections.Counter)) (*args, **kwds) la Python3 # explicit function def fun(a, b):     return a**b    # import required … Continue reading «¿Cómo obtener una lista de nombres de parámetros de una función en Python?»

Pasar por referencia vs valor en Python

Los desarrolladores que saltan a la programación de Python desde otros lenguajes como C++ y Java a menudo se confunden con el proceso de pasar argumentos en Python. El modelo de datos centrado en objetos y su tratamiento de asignación es la causa detrás de la confusión en el nivel fundamental.  En el artículo, discutiremos … Continue reading «Pasar por referencia vs valor en Python»

método de clase() en Python

classmethod () es una función incorporada en Python, que devuelve un método de clase para una función dada; Sintaxis: classmethod(función) Parámetro: esta función acepta el nombre de la función como parámetro. Tipo de devolución: esta función devuelve el método de clase convertido. También puede usar el decorador @classmethod para la definición de classmethod. Sintaxis:  @classmethod … Continue reading «método de clase() en Python»

Parámetro solo posicional en Python3.8

Python presenta la nueva sintaxis de función en la versión Python3.8.2 , donde podemos introducir la /barra inclinada para comparar el parámetro posicional que viene antes de la /barra y los parámetros que vienen después *son argumentos de palabra clave. El resto de los argumentos que se interponen /y *pueden ser de tipo posicional o … Continue reading «Parámetro solo posicional en Python3.8»

Python | Resto decimal_near() método

Decimal#remainder_near() : resto_near() es un método de clase Decimal que devuelve x – y * n, donde n es el número entero más cercano al valor exacto de x / y Sintaxis: Decimal.remainder_near() Parámetro: Valores decimales Devuelve: x – y * n, donde n es el número entero más cercano al valor exacto de x … Continue reading «Python | Resto decimal_near() método»